ICC T20 Rankings: Saim Ayub Reclaims Top All-Rounder Spot

Gravatar Avatar Web Desk | 3 months ago

The International Cricket Council has released the latest player rankings ahead of the T20 World Cup, bringing major changes for Pakistani players. Saim Ayub has once again become the number one T20 all-rounder, while Babar Azam dropped in the batting list, making the latest ICC T20 rankings a key talking point for cricket fans.

In the all-rounders category, Pakistan’s Saim Ayub returned to the top position, while Zimbabwe’s Sikandar Raza slipped to second place. Mohammad Nawaz moved up one spot to fourth, and Shadab Khan made a strong comeback by jumping 13 places to reach 26th position.

In the T20 batters rankings, India’s Abhishek Sharma holds the top spot, followed by England’s Phil Salt at second. Jos Buttler climbed one position to third place. Among Pakistani batters, Sahibzada Farhan dropped two spots to seventh, while Saim Ayub improved eight places to reach 28th.

Pakistan’s T20 captain Salman Ali Agha made a big move by climbing 12 positions to 29th. Former captain Babar Azam slipped three places to 34th, while Fakhar Zaman, who is part of the T20 World Cup squad, dropped five spots to 74th.

In the bowlers rankings, India’s Varun Chakravarthy remains number one. Pakistan’s Abrar Ahmed climbed two spots to second, pushing Afghanistan’s Rashid Khan to third. Mohammad Nawaz and Shaheen Afridi also improved their positions, highlighting Pakistan’s progress in the latest ICC T20 rankings.
